Avon announced a partnership with Lewiston-born actor Patrick Dempsey on Monday to create a new signature fragrance for men. No name has been released for the fragrance, which is set to debut in November.
“This is an extremely exciting opportunity for me to work with Avon – a brand I have long respected as a global powerhouse with a lot of heart and soul,” Dempsey said in a statement from the company.
His wife, makeup artist Jillian Dempsey, has been Avon’s global creative color director since 2006.
This is the first time creating fragrances for Dempsey, who grew up in Buckfield. “He will be actively involved with every aspect of the project,” according to the company’s statement.
The actor recently donated $250,000 to begin fundraising for the Patrick Dempsey Center for Cancer Hope & Healing at CMMC, the hospital where he was born. The center opened its doors Monday.
In 2007, Dempsey won both a Screen Actor’s Guild Award and a People’s Choice Award for his role as Dr. Shepherd – aka “Dr. McDreamy” – on the ABC show “Grey’s Anatomy.” He most recently appeared in the Disney film “Enchanted.”
